Course Content

• Autobiographical Theory and Disability Studies
• Narrative Strategies and Identity Construction in Disability Autobiographies
• Disability, Culture, and Representation: Examining Autobiographical Texts
• The Social Model of Disability and its Impact on Autobiographical Writing
• Medical Model of Disability vs. Social Model: A Comparative Analysis in Autobiographies
• Intersectionality and Disability: Exploring Multiple Identities in Autobiography
• Ethics and Representation in Disability Autobiographies
• Publishing and Advocacy: Sharing Your Disability Story
• Trauma, Resilience, and Healing in Disability Narratives
